HIGGINS, Patrick M. Patrick M. Higgins, 26, of Terryville, died Saturday (October 13, 2007) at Brigham & Women's Hospital, Boston, MA. He was born in Hartford, son of Patrick and Mary Ann Higgins of Foster RI. He received his Bachelors Degree from Central Connecticut State University...
